Militaria show on in Greerton

Anyone with an interest in historical military pieces will enjoy the Tauranga Militaria Show on March 22-23. Photo / Supplied

Take a trip down memory lane, or see something you’ve never set your eyes on before at the 2025 Tauranga Militaria Show this Saturday, March 22, and Sunday, March 23.

Show organiser Dave Cross said there will be exhibits that will excite budding or long-standing collectors alike – or anyone with an interest in historical military pieces.

“There’ll be all sorts there! There’ll be stuff for the likes of militaria collectors, those who are into sporting firearms, knives. Then there’s medals, swords, bayonets and much more!”

If you’re new to collecting or interested in getting started, there will be plenty of people to have a chat to – including dealers and people who have been collecting for years, said Cross.

“Bring along your own items of interest too. You can have it appraised or sell it on.”

The Tauranga Militaria Show is in Greerton Hall from 9am-4pm on Saturday, March 22, and 10am-3pm on Sunday, March 23. Entry is $10 each, and children under-12 can enter for free but they must be accompanied by an adult.
